Tool-Flo offers a solutionwith a Continued on Page 6 turing turing Corp has expanded its Summit family of lathes with the addition of the new Summit 35-52 Big Swing Lathe se- ries. These big swing heavy-duty lathes feature extrawide hardened and preci- sion ground bed ways, clutched head- stocks fitted with precision ground gears in stepped or variable speed models, a 6.1-inch spindle mounted in special angular contact thrust bearings for accuracy and smooth running and an integral feed and thread gear box with a wide range of inch and metric threads available at the turn of a lever, the company said.
